Yes, cherry blossom trees can grow in Las Vegas, NV, but they require specific care due to the region's hot, arid climate. To thrive, they should be planted in well-drained soil and receive adequate water, particularly during the hot summer months. Choosing heat-tolerant varieties and providing some afternoon shade can also help ensure their success in this environment. Proper maintenance will promote healthy growth and blooming.

Cherry blossom trees typically grow at a moderate pace compared to other types of trees. They can grow around 1 to 2 feet per year, which is considered a moderate growth rate in the tree world.
Cherry blossom trees typically grow at a rate of 1 to 2 feet per year. Factors that can affect their growth rate include soil quality, sunlight exposure, water availability, and temperature.
